Assessment of a Vaginal Ring With Meloxicam on Ovarian Cycle in Fertile Women

Brief Summary
In this study, the investigators propose to assess if a non-hormonal agent is absorbed by a local route (vaginal) and to observe the effect on follicular development.

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Previous (or history of) proven fertility
- Regular menstrual cycle
- Surgically sterile
- Without breastfeeding
- Haemoglobin at least 11g/dL
- Willing to participate in the study
Exclusion
- Allergy to meloxicam or other NSAID
- Allergy to silicone polymer
- Vaginal discharge non diagnosticated
- History of shock toxic syndrome
- History of : gastrointestinal, bleeding, renal, liver, heart, brain,clot, endocrine or pulmonary disorders
